How South32’s FY26 Manganese Cut And Hermosa Update At South32 (ASX:S32) Has Changed Its Investment Story

South32 Limited recently reported its March 2026 quarter and year-to-date production, alongside confirming most FY26 production guidance but cutting Australia Manganese output guidance by 6% due to elevated site water levels and recent severe weather impacts. The company also scheduled a special call to update investors on its Hermosa project, underscoring the growing importance of this US growth asset within South32’s portfolio. ANZ Group Holdings (ASX:ANZ) Margin Compression Puts Bullish Narratives To The Test

ANZ Group Holdings (ASX:ANZ) has put fresh numbers on the table for H1 2026, with total revenue for the most recent half year at A$10.7 billion and basic EPS at A$0.76, set against trailing 12 month revenue of A$21.5 billion and EPS of A$1.98. Over recent halves, the bank has seen revenue move from A$10.1 billion in H2 2024 to A$11.0 billion in H1 2025 and A$10.7 billion in H2 2025, while basic EPS shifted from A$1.04 to A$1.23 and then A$0.76. Does Whitehaven Coal’s (ASX:WHC) New 6.25% Bond Shape a Smarter Capital Structure or Add Complexity?

In late April 2026, Whitehaven Coal announced a secured senior fixed-income offering of US$450 million in 6.25% notes due October 22, 2031, alongside its now-completed Q3 2026 earnings call. Together, the new bond issue and recent earnings update give investors fresh insight into Whitehaven’s funding mix, balance sheet flexibility, and capital allocation priorities.
